SCR 22 Louisiana Senate · 2025 Regular Session

UTILITIES: Requests the adoption of enhanced regional transmission planning processes that use a multi-scenario, multi-value framework to ensure long-term national security, grid reliability, and resilience.

This resolution urges regional electricity grid planners (like MISO and SPP) to adopt new planning methods that consider long-term risks such as hurricanes, cyberattacks, and extreme weather. It specifically requests using 20-year planning horizons, evaluating projects based on national security, reliability, and cost fairness, and ensuring Louisiana ratepayers aren’t disproportionately burdened. The resolution directly affects grid operators and Louisiana’s electricity customers by shaping how transmission projects are assessed and funded. It does not create new law but requests specific planning approaches for grid resilience.
